Some analysts had feared a sharp influx of low-priced commodity imports from Asia (or from nations that typically sell into Asia) but latest numbers from napm say it's not happening. Nineteen percent of PMs surveyed in December reported an increase in materials imports, up from 13% in November. In January, however, the figure dropped to 15% and last month it fell back to 13%. Materials imports, according to napm, are said to be growing, albeit at a slowing rate.
